    On its maiden voyage, the Soviet nuclear-powered submarine K-19 suffers a complete loss of coolant to its reactor. The crew are able to effect repairs, but 22 of them die of radiation poisoning over the following two years. Date: July 4, 1961 Read more on Wikipedia → 📅 Other events on July 4 📅 Events…

    Barbados, Guyana, Jamaica, and Trinidad and Tobago sign the Treaty of Chaguaramas in Chaguaramas, Trinidad and Tobago establishing the Caribbean Community (CARICOM). It replaces the Caribbean Free Trade Association as another step towards Caribbean regional integration. Date: July 4, 1973 Read more on Wikipedia → 📅 Other events on July 4 📅 Events on this…
